‘Only PKR candidates from strong divisions’


KUALA TERENGGANU: PKR candidates for the next general election will only be from divisions with strong membership and grassroots machinery.

The criteria for selection would also include the level of programme activity carried out at division level, PKR president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im said.

“Even if the central leadership proposes a candidate, I will reject it if the division does not have sufficient members or is weak.

“It is better for us to focus on areas with strong leadership,” he told the Terengganu PKR mini convention at the Terengganu Equestrian Resort.

Also present were PKR vice-president and Science, Technology and Innovation Minister Datuk Chang Lih Kang; PKR secretary-general and Deputy Domestic Trade and Cost of Living Minister Datuk Dr Fuziah Salleh; and PKR information chief and Communications Minister Datuk Fahmi Fadzil.

The Prime Minister urged PKR members in Terengganu to consistently convey clear information about the government’s efforts to ensure the people’s well-being, particularly initiatives to eradicate poverty, Bernama reported.

“Our main priority is to lift those out of the hardcore poor category.

“To resolve poverty, there must be investment, improvements and economic growth, as well as funding. So who should convey this? You are the ones who should deliver the message,” he said.

Met by reporters after the programme, Anwar said the party would leave it to the state PKR leaderships to determine the number of seats to be contested in each state in GE16.
